Classification of Austrian winesWith

minor but fundamental differences, it is similar to the German classification and, like that one - is trying to reach the final shape, which makes it still difficult for many people to figure out. The lowest classification is table wines, or Tafelwein. Above it are regional wines, or Landwein. Above that are located quality wines, called Qualitätswein, whose elevated category is Kabinett. Next are Prädikatswein, or quality wines with a distinction, starting with Spätlese, followed by Auslese, Beerenauslese (BE), Strohwein, Ausbruch, Eiswein and Trockenbeerenauslese (TBA). A separate gradation has only one region. - Wachau. In addition to the aforementioned gradations, the new DAC appellation designations are used in addition.

Grape VarietiesAustria

is associated primarily with white wines, and indeed has a great track record in this area. The emblematic variety is the autochthonous Grüner Veltliner varietal. The best white wines from Austria are also made from Riesling, Welschrieling, Müller-Thurgau, Neuburger, Rotgipfler and other local varieties, as well as Sauvignon Blanc, Pinot Blanc, Muscat and Chardonnay. Red wines are primarily Zweigelt, Blaufränkisch, Blauer Portugieser, Saint Laurent, and Pinot Noir,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ot and Syrah. An interesting feature is Blauer Wildbacher, which produces Silcher Sturm, a rosé wine sold just after fermentation.

Recommended winesAustrian wines

on our site are gaining popularity, and the most popular varietal is Grüner Veltliner, yielding distinctive wines that are lively, expressive and very aromatic, with spicy and herbal notes. We particularly recommend the Esterhazy Classic Beerenauslese Burgenland wine, which is made from late-harvested, ripest fruit affected by noble mold. It captivates with the subtle sweetness of honey, candied fruit, jam and quince with delicate minerality and an elegant hint of crispness. It is a coupage of two local varietals grown with great care and precision so that we can taste an excellent white sweet wine of superb quality with a thick, buttery texture. Riesling is another varietal that succeeds well here, offering wines that are nicely balanced, with good extractivity and acidity. Of the red varieties, one should certainly mention the typically tannic Zweigelt, the Blaufränkisch that matures quickly here, as well as Blauer Portugieser and Sankt Laurent.
